Comprehending the Different Types of Treadmills
When strolling into a respectable treadmill store, buyers will experience several unique categories of devices, each created to satisfy specific physical fitness needs and space restraints. Understanding these distinctions forms the structure of a notified purchasing choice.
Manual treadmills represent the many standard option readily available in the majority of shops. These devices run without electrical motors, meaning the belt moves only when the user strolls or runs. While they tend to be more economical and compact, manual treadmills can put additional strain on joints considering that the user must generate all forward momentum. They work well for people who mainly plan light walking or who have restricted flooring area in their homes.
Motorized treadmills dominate the industrial and home fitness market, using automated slope settings, predetermined exercise programs, and constant belt speeds. These machines vary from standard models suitable for walking to advanced units developed for high-intensity interval training and major runners. The quality of the motor, measured in continuous horsepower, substantially impacts the maker's performance and longevity. A quality treadmill shop will usually equip models covering multiple horse power rankings to accommodate different exercise strengths.
Folding treadmills have actually acquired remarkable popularity among home fitness enthusiasts who should balance their workout equipment with minimal living space. These makers include hydraulic systems that allow the deck to raise vertically after usage, often minimizing the footprint by half. Modern styles have actually lessened the conventional compromise between folding convenience and structural stability, with lots of models providing the very same robust building and construction as their non-folding equivalents.
Commercial-grade treadmills found in specialty treadmill shops withstand continuous usage in fitness facilities and typically feature much heavier frames, more effective motors, and additional cushioning systems. While these machines carry higher price points, their durability and advanced functions make them appealing to major runners and those planning frequent day-to-day usage.
Important Features to Evaluate
Beyond fundamental categories, an educated treadmill shop representative can guide buyers through the technical requirements that differentiate quality equipment from low quality choices. The running surface measurements rank amongst the most important factors to consider, as inadequate belt length can disrupt natural stride patterns and increase injury danger. Standard surface areas normally determine 55 to 60 inches in length and 20 to 22 inches in width, though taller or larger individuals may require extended measurements.
Motor power directly correlates with smooth operation and the machine's capability to keep consistent speeds under differing user weights. Continuous duty horse power, rather than peak horsepower, provides the most precise efficiency indicator. Treadmills meant for walking generally require 2.0 to 2.5 CHP, while running and training applications gain from 3.0 CHP or greater. Shoppers should confirm that the motor requirements shows continuousduty rankings, as some manufacturers list peak performance numbers that overstate real-world capabilities.
Cushioning systems deserve attention from consumers worried about joint health. Quality treadmills integrate elastomeric cushions or similar shock-absorption mechanisms between the deck and frame, lowering impact forces by 15 to 40 percent compared to outdoor running surface areas. This function proves particularly important for heavier users, older grownups, and individuals with pre-existing joint conditions.
Console technology has actually developed considerably in current years, transforming treadmills into advanced home entertainment and tracking centers. Fundamental consoles screen speed, range, time, and calorie expense, while advanced units include touchscreen screens, interactive workout programs, heart rate monitoring, and integration with physical fitness apps and streaming services. Purchasers need to think about how smartphone connection, Bluetooth compatibility, and integrated exercise variety align with their inspirational requirements and tech choices.

Budget Plan Considerations and Value Assessment
Establishing a reasonable budget assists narrow options effectively during the shopping process. While temptation exists to buy the least expensive model offered, this method typically results in premature equipment failure, bad exercise experiences, and ultimately greater long-lasting costs. Industry specialists normally suggest allocating at least ₤ 1,000 to ₤ 1,500 for a home treadmill planned for routine usage, with ₤ 2,000 to ₤ 3,000 offering the optimal balance of functions, construction quality, and resilience for the majority of households.
Purchasers should thoroughly analyze guarantee terms before purchasing. Quality treadmills usually feature lifetime coverage on frames, extended guarantees on motors and electronics, and labor protection for the first year or more. A treadmill store offering suspiciously low rates along with very little guarantee protection may be selling terminated designs with limited parts accessibility or refurbished devices with questionable dependability.

Often Asked Questions
Just how much area does a typical treadmill require?
Most basic treadmills need approximately 7 feet in length, 3 feet in width, and 5 to 6 feet in height when in use. Folding models reduce the horizontal footprint substantially when stored, though buyers ought to verify the unfolded and folded measurements before acquiring. Determining the designated installation area, including clearance for access and emergency dismounts, avoids frustrating收货后安装 obstacles.
What upkeep do treadmills routinely require?
Regular upkeep consists of weekly belt cleansing, monthly lubrication of the walking belt, regular belt tension adjustment, and regular vacuuming beneath and around the device. Most quality treadmills include lubrication kits and maintenance schedules in their user manuals. Avoiding excessive wear, keeping the machine on suitable floor covering, and addressing uncommon sounds without delay extend operational lifespan considerably.
Is a treadmill purchase worthwhile for someone who mainly strolls?
Absolutely. Treadmills offer constant, shock-absorbing surface areas ideal for walking exercise. Modern makers offer slope capabilities that increase cardiovascular benefits without effect strength, while predetermined programs help preserve exercise range and inspiration. The convenience of home treadmill gain access to often increases workout frequency compared to relying on outside walking or health club sees.
The length of time do home treadmills usually last?
With correct upkeep and reasonable use patterns, quality home treadmills last 7 to 12 years. Motors and electronics frequently bring warranties of 5 to ten years from respectable manufacturers. Devices life expectancy correlates highly with preliminary purchase quality, with budget designs typically requiring replacement after 3 to 5 years of routine use.
